What is the Goethe Language Proficiency Certificate?
Administered by the Goethe-Institut, the cultural institute of the Federal Republic of Germany, these language certificates are globally recognized by employers, universities, and government authorities. Based upon the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), the exams evaluate a prospect's efficiency across four core skills: Reading, Listening, Writing, and Speaking.
The certificates cover six levels, ranging from absolute newbies to near-native speakers:
- A1 & & A2: Elementary Language Use
- B1 & & B2: Independent Language Use
- C1 & & C2: Proficient Language Use
Why Do You Need a Goethe Certificate?
Having an official certification on paper modifications how the world perceives linguistic capability. Here are the main reasons individuals pursue certification:
- Higher Education in Germany: Most German-taught degree programs require a Goethe-Zertifikat C1 or TestDAF for admission.
- Visa and Immigration: The German embassy typically mandates a recognized certificate (generally A1 or B1) for household reunion visas, long-term residency, or citizenship applications.
- Profession Opportunities: Multinational corporations, particularly those headquartered in German-speaking nations or working globally, worth accredited bilingual workers.
- Personal Milestone: Passing an extensive examination offers a concrete sense of accomplishment and validates years of research study.
The Traditional Path: How to Earn the Certificate
For candidates who wish to sit for the main evaluations, the procedure needs structured preparation, registration, and testing.
Step-by-Step Examination Process
- Evaluate Current Level: Take a placement test to determine whether to study for A1, B2, C1, and so on.
- Prepare Thoroughly: Utilize Goethe-Institut textbooks, online courses, and practice exams. Focus greatly on output skills (writing and speaking).
- Register Online: Visit the main Goethe-Institut site or an authorized local partner (such as a Goethe-Zentrum) to book a test slot. Slots fill quickly, so book months ahead of time.
- Take the Exam: Complete both the composed modules (Reading, Listening, Writing) and the oral module (Speaking, which is often conducted face-to-face with inspectors).
- Get Results: Results are generally published within two to 6 weeks. Upon passing, candidates receive a physical certificate with life time validity.

Tips for Passing the Goethe Exam on Your First Try
For those committing to the standard screening route, tactical preparation makes all the difference.
- Familiarize Yourself with the Format: The Goethe examination has an extremely particular structure. Knowing what the inspectors expect in the composing prompts or listening sections prevents surprises on test day.
- Practice Under Timed Conditions: Many trainees have a hard time not with the German language itself, but with completing the reading and writing areas within the allocated time frame.
- Immerse Yourself: Listen to German podcasts, read regional news outlets (like Deutsche Welle), and reverse with native speakers frequently.
- Take Mock Tests: Utilize totally free model documents available on the Goethe-Institut website to grade yourself accurately.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. For how long is a Goethe language certificate valid?
Goethe-Institut certificates do not have an expiration date. Once made, they stay legitimate for life. However, some universities or companies might ask for a more current certificate (e.g., within the last 2 years) if they think your language skills have degraded due to absence of usage.
2. Can I take the Goethe examination online?
The Goethe-Institut offers digital tests (Goethe-zertifikat goethe digital) at select test centers. Nevertheless, these still usually need prospects to be physically present at an authorized test center to preserve security and integrity requirements.
3. What occurs if I fail one part of the exam?
In most cases, if you stop working the overall test but pass particular modules, policies might vary by test center. Historically, you frequently had to retake the whole test, though modular screening options are significantly ending up being readily available for higher levels. Contact your specific test center for their retake policy.
4. Is the Goethe certificate acknowledged worldwide?
Yes. The Goethe-Institut is worldwide acknowledged as the premier authority on the German language. Its certificates are accepted by universities, companies, and federal governments around the world.
5. What is the difference in between TestDAF and the Goethe C1 certificate?
While both show advanced German proficiency for university admission, TestDAF is heavily academic and standardized into particular scoring bands (TDN 3, 4, and 5). The Goethe-zertifikat goethe institut C1 is a more basic proficiency examination that examines holistic language usage in scholastic, social, and expert contexts.
